A presentation -- I gave -- aimed at building a healthy mental model of C++, without detailing the many dark corners of C++; it starts from the basics and ends at an intermediate level - thereon the viewer can comfortably pursue learning the language from more formal sources.

The slide deck, loaded with links to official sources to justify the claims made, can be viewed on a mobile too :)

Slide deck and code shared at GitHub under BSD-3 license.
